How they compare

OECD members currently reports 455.55 million against 29.65 million in Turkey, a difference of 425.90 million.

That makes OECD members's figure about 15.4 times Turkey's.

Across all 66 years both countries report, OECD members has been ahead every year.

OECD members ranks 17th and Turkey ranks 17th of 45 groups.

OECD members has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ade OECD members Turkey Difference Ahead
1960s 259.17 million 8.61 million 250.56 million OECD members
1970s 298.68 million 11.15 million 287.53 million OECD members
1980s 342.44 million 14.57 million 327.87 million OECD members
1990s 380.99 million 18.82 million 362.17 million OECD members
2000s 414.86 million 22.66 million 392.19 million OECD members
2010s 439.49 million 26.74 million 412.74 million OECD members
2020s 451.63 million 29.23 million 422.40 million OECD members

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
